site stats

Loss function for siamese network

Web6 de mai. de 2024 · Introduction. Siamese Networks are neural networks which share weights between two or more sister networks, each producing embedding vectors of its respective inputs. In supervised similarity learning, the networks are then trained to maximize the contrast (distance) between embeddings of inputs of different classes, … Web6 de mai. de 2024 · This paper has proposed a convolutional neural network using an extension architecture of the traditional Siamese network so-called Siamese-Difference …

arXiv:1912.00385v4 [cs.CV] 20 Jul 2024

WebIn this paper, we examine two strategies for boosting the performance of ensembles of Siamese networks (SNNs) for image classification using two loss functions (Triplet … Web16 de mai. de 2024 · For training the network, we take an anchor image and randomly sample positive and negative images and compute its loss function and update its … how far is it from kennewick wa to boise id https://oceanbeachs.com

US20240089335A1 - Training method for robust neural network …

Web24 de nov. de 2024 · Enroll for Free. This Course. Video Transcript. In this course, you will: • Compare Functional and Sequential APIs, discover new models you can build with the Functional API, and build a model that produces multiple outputs including a Siamese network. • Build custom loss functions (including the contrastive loss function used in … Web3 de mar. de 2024 · Contrastive loss has been used recently in a number of papers showing state of the art results with unsupervised learning. MoCo, PIRL, and SimCLR all follow very similar patterns of using a siamese network with contrastive loss. When reading these papers I found that the general idea was very straight forward but the … Webfor feature embedding was done in the seminal work of Siamese Networks [4]. A cost function called contrastive loss was designed in such a way as to minimize the distance between pairs of images belonging to the same cluster, and maxi-mize the distance between pairs of images coming from di erent clusters. In [6], how far is it from kelowna to kamloops

Siamese Network: Prediction Accuracy and Training Loss

Category:How Siamese Neural Networks Work With Image Processing

Tags:Loss function for siamese network

Loss function for siamese network

Contrastive Loss for Siamese Networks with Keras and …

Webloss function should process target output of loaders and outputs from the model: Examples: Classification: batch loader, classification model, NLL loss, accuracy metric: … Web3. Deep Siamese Networks for Image Verification Siamese nets were first introduced in the early 1990s by Bromley and LeCun to solve signature verification as an image matching problem (Bromley et al.,1993). A siamese neural network consists of twin networks which accept dis-tinct inputs but are joined by an energy function at the top.

Loss function for siamese network

Did you know?

Web25 de mar. de 2024 · A Siamese Network is a type of network architecture that contains two or more identical subnetworks used to generate feature vectors for each input and … WebThe Siamese neural network architecture [22] of two towers with shared weights and a distance function at the last layer has been effective in learning similarities in domains such as text [23 ...

Web24 de ago. de 2024 · The contrastive loss should be using this formula: (1. - y_true) * square_pred + y_true * margin_square However, when I came across the siamese … Web6 de abr. de 2024 · Many resources use this function as a loss function: def contrastive_loss (y_true, y_pred): margin = 1 return K.mean (y_true * K.square …

WebCustom Models, Layers, and Loss Functions with TensorFlow. In this course, you will: • Compare Functional and Sequential APIs, discover new models you can build with the … WebA Siamese network includes several, typically two or three, backbone neural networks which share weights [5] (see Fig. 1). Different loss functions have been proposed for training a Siamese ...

Web1 de mar. de 2016 · Actually found out something odd about the implementation of the contrastive loss function in the siamese example: I corrected the implementation in my …

Web30 de nov. de 2024 · To actually train the siamese network architecture, we have a number of loss functions that we can utilize, including binary cross-entropy, triplet loss, and … high away facebookWeb14 de abr. de 2024 · 下图是Siamese network的基础架构,其中Input 1和Input 2是需要比较相似度的输入,它们通过两个具有相同架构、参数和权重的相似子网络(Network 1和Network 2)并输出特征编码,最终经过损失函数(Loss)的计算,得到两个输入的相似度量。例如,第一个分量的单位是kg,第二个分量的单位是g,这意味着所 ... how far is it from kansas city to denverWeb11 de abr. de 2024 · where P(m) is the probability density function of the predicted scores, Q(m) is the probability density function of the ground truth, and \(\sigma \) is the sigmoid function. In the loss function, a new regularization coefficient, \(\epsilon \), is introduced, to force the network to learn mismatched samples better and thus improve the fraud … high a west standingsWeb9 de mar. de 2024 · Essentially, contrastive loss is evaluating how good a job the siamese network is distinguishing between the image pairs. The difference is subtle but incredibly important. To break this equation down: The. , minus the distance. We’ll be implementing this loss function using Keras and TensorFlow later in this tutorial. how far is it from kings cross to paddingtonWebEnglish. Desktop only. In this 2-hour long guided-project course, you will learn how to implement a Siamese Network, you will train the network with the Triplet loss function. You will create Anchor, Positive and Negative image dataset, which will be the inputs of triplet loss function, through which the network will learn feature embeddings. how far is it from kingman az to tucumcari nmWebThe Siamese network architecture is illustrated in the following diagram. To compare two images, each image is passed through one of two identical subnetworks that share weights. The subnetworks convert each 105-by-105-by-1 image to a 4096-dimensional feature vector. Images of the same class have similar 4096-dimensional representations. high awareness definitionWebtraining model for Siamese network with triplet loss function consists of three copies of same network of CNN, it takes text 1, text 2 and text 3 as the inputs, while one with … how far is it from kingman az to oatman az